was created to bring affordable versions of common but high-priced generic medicines to market.
Generic medicines are often a low-cost alternative to brand-name drugs, but in recent years, the price of some generics has increased substantially, raising costs for health plans and consumers. High out-of-pocket costs have forced some consumers to make painful trade-offs, such as cutting back on groceries or putting their health at risk by rationing their medicine or worse – leaving it at the pharmacy counter because they simply can’t afford it.
CivicaScript and its members are intent on addressing that problem.
CivicaScript was created in 2020 in partnership with Civica and numerous Blue Cross Blue Shield organizations to bring affordable versions of common but high-priced generic medicines to market. Our research showed that we could manufacture and distribute quality generic medicines for a fraction of the price many consumers currently pay.
We are a statutory public benefit company that is committed to the principles of providing affordable generic medications in a manner that promotes the social welfare and health of the community. CivicaScript is a sister company to Civica, Inc. (Civica Rx), which was created in 2018 as a nonprofit public asset to help prevent chronic shortages of hospital-based medicines — and the price spikes that often accompany them.
